Orthodontic treatment carries risks that vary between individuals. These include discomfort and ulceration during adjustment, shortening of the tooth roots (root resorption), decalcification or decay where oral hygiene is inadequate around fixed appliances, gum inflammation, jaw joint discomfort, and in some cases the need for tooth extraction or referral for surgical correction.
Teeth tend to move after treatment finishes. Retainers must be worn as instructed, usually indefinitely, and relapse can occur if they are not. Treatment times quoted are estimates only and depend substantially on your biological response and on how consistently removable aligners are worn.
Not every case can be treated with clear aligners, and some cases fall outside the scope of general dental practice. Where that applies we will refer you to a registered specialist orthodontist. Your dentist will discuss the risks, alternatives and likely duration in your case before you consent to treatment. Invisalign is a popular orthodontic treatment known for its clear, removable aligners that gradually straighten your teeth — a discreet, comfortable path to a confident smile.
Made from a strong, medical-grade plastic called SmartTrack, these custom-designed aligners gently shift your teeth into position over time. You wear a series of progressively aligned trays for about two weeks each, with every new tray nudging your teeth closer to their final alignment.

Treatment generally takes 6 months to 2 years, depending on your case. Here is how it works.
A 3D digital scan creates a precise model of your smile and a custom plan.
Wear each aligner ~2 weeks, 20–22 hrs/day, swapping to the next in the series.
Easy progress reviews to keep everything on track and adjust as needed.
A retainer keeps your new, straight smile perfectly in place for the long term.

Read Our Google ReviewsInvisalign is a clear aligner system that gradually straightens teeth using custom-made plastic trays. Each tray is worn for about two weeks to shift teeth closer to the desired position.
Treatment duration varies, typically ranging from 6 months to 2 years depending on the complexity of your case. Your dentist will give a more accurate timeframe during the consultation.
Yes — aligners are removable, so you can eat and drink without restrictions. Just remember to remove them before eating to prevent damage.
Clear aligners are effective for mild to moderate misalignment, but may not be suitable for severe cases — where traditional braces may work better. A consultation is essential to determine eligibility.
For best results, aligners should be worn 20–22 hours daily, removing them only for eating, drinking and brushing.
